NDC promises to establish college of Education at Afram Plains

NDC promises to establish college of Education at Afram Plains

Share on FacebookShare on TwitterShare on Whatsapp

The member of Parliament for Builsa South, Dr. Clement Apaak has stated that the NDC will establish Teacher Training college at Afram Plains in the next NDC administration.

According to him, there is a challenge of acute professional Teachers shortage in that enclave and the only way to address that challenge is establish College of Education in that jurisdiction.

Delivering a keynote address at NDC 2024 manifesto Sectoral press briefing on August 27, 2024, the member of parliament also said Teachers who accept postings to rural and underserved communities will receive special allowance of 20% on basic salary.

Adding that, the NDC will go further to abolish the Teacher Licensure examination and integrate the licensure process into the final year examination of trainees whiles they still in School.

Above all, NPP mandatory national service scheme will be scrapped for teacher trainee graduates and restore the automatic employment of newly qualified teachers.

In other words, the NDC will partner with Teacher unions to initiate government assisted mortgage scheme to support Teachers to own their own houses, flexible duty payment will also be offered to Teachers to own their vehicles of their choice.

“John Dramani Mahama has a proven record in the area of Education and can be trusted to deliver on these and many other promises and therefore Ghanaians should vote for Mahama to ensure that every Ghanaian child gets qualify education “.
